The Naval Live Oaks Area, part of the Gulf Islands National Seashore near Gulf Breeze, Florida, offers visitors over 7.5 miles of scenic hiking trails through diverse coastal landscapes include the Naval Live Oaks Trail.
• Park Hours: Open daily from 8:00 AM to sunset.
• Entrance Fee: There is no entrance fee to access the Naval Live Oaks Area.
• Permits: No permits are required for day-use activities such as hiking.
• Availability: Parking is available near the park headquarters at 1801 Gulf Breeze Parkway, Gulf Breeze, FL 32563.
• Trails: Pets are allowed on the trails and bike paths but must be kept on a leash.
• Beaches: Pets are not permitted on the beaches or in the sand areas.
• Restrooms: Public restrooms are available near the picnic areas.
• Picnic Areas: Designated picnic spots equipped with tables and grills are available for visitor use.
• Wildlife Viewing: The area is a haven for birdwatchers, especially during migration seasons, with opportunities to spot various wood-warblers and other species.
• Visitor Center: The visitor center has permanently closed; however, park information is available at the headquarters.
